What Does Professional Home Staging Actually Do?
Professional staging evaluates how the property’s existing spaces are likely to be experienced by potential buyers.
Depending on the individual home, a staging strategy may address:
- Furniture placement.
- Furniture scale.
- Room flow.
- Decluttering.
- Room purpose.
- Visual balance.
- Accessories.
- Lighting.
- Photography preparation.
- Outdoor-living presentation.
Good staging should make it easier for buyers to see the home rather than focusing on the furnishings inside it.
Staging Can Help Buyers Understand Room Scale
Large rooms are not always easy to understand from photographs or during a quick showing.
Furniture that is too large, too small or poorly positioned can affect how buyers perceive room dimensions and traffic flow.
Professional staging can help demonstrate how the space functions while allowing important architectural characteristics to remain visible.
Staging Can Improve Floor-Plan Flow
Custer Creek Farms properties can have distinctive floor plans with formal and informal living spaces, offices, game rooms and other flexible areas.
Clear furniture placement can help buyers understand how rooms relate to one another and how different areas of the home may be used.
When buyers can understand the floor plan quickly, they can spend more time considering whether the property fits their lifestyle.

Professional Staging Can Improve Listing Photography
Many potential buyers will experience your property online before deciding whether to schedule a showing.
Professional staging can help photography communicate:
- Room scale.
- Architectural details.
- Natural light.
- Floor-plan relationships.
- Renovated spaces.
- Indoor-outdoor connections.
- Overall presentation.
Photography and staging should work together to help buyers understand why the individual property deserves closer consideration.
Does Staging Mean Replacing Everything in the Home?
No. Professional staging does not automatically mean removing all existing furniture or bringing in an entirely new collection of furnishings.
Depending on the individual property, recommendations may involve:
- Repositioning existing furniture.
- Removing excess pieces.
- Simplifying accessories.
- Clarifying room purpose.
- Reducing visual distractions.
- Supplementing selected spaces when appropriate.
The appropriate approach depends on the home.
Staging Does Not Replace Property Preparation
Professional staging cannot solve every condition or maintenance concern.
Repairs, paint, flooring, lighting, landscaping and other preparation decisions should be evaluated separately when appropriate.
Staging works best as one component of a coordinated preparation strategy.

Should staging happen before professional photography?
Yes. When staging is part of the selling strategy, it should generally be completed before photography so the online presentation reflects the intended showing experience.
Can staging replace needed repairs?
No. Staging and property condition are different considerations. Repairs and maintenance should be evaluated separately as part of the complete preparation strategy.
